2. Personalising service user engagement : entrepreneurs and membership organisations in the mental health sector
Sammanfattning : New modes of social mobilisation are emerging in the mental health sector. Member-based mental health service user organisations (MHSUOs), targeting people with lived experience of mental ill-health and occasionally their relatives, have been active in Sweden since the 1960s. 3. Social capital in healthcare : A resource for sustainable engagement in organizational improvement work
Sammanfattning : Social capital, work engagement, working conditions, and leadership are concepts that have been studied previously, but there is lack of knowledge about what processes promote sustainable organizational improvement work in hospitals, and specifically, what leads healthcare professionals to engage in clinical developments.The overall aim of this thesis is to increase knowledge of how social capital and engagement contribute to sustainable organizational improvement work in hospitals and how social capital and engagement are created during organizational improvement work. 4. Attitudes matter : Perceptions towards welfare work with migrants in Swedish welfare organisations
Sammanfattning : This dissertation examines Swedish welfare workers’ attitudes towards migrants and migration, their perceptions of welfare work with migrants and organisational working conditions.
